Understanding the Impact of Bacterial Contamination: Bacterial contamination poses a significant threat to cell culture systems, impacting cell viability, proliferation, and experimental reproducibility. Common contaminants include mycoplasma, gram-positive and gram-negative bacteria, which can enter cultures through improper aseptic techniques, contaminated reagents, or unclean equipment.
